A dual approach to tracheobronchial foreign bodies in children
Insights
A new protocol for pediatric tracheobronchial foreign bodies showed success. Nonoperative treatment for peripheral cases and bronchoscopic removal for central cases resulted in no deaths or permanent damage.

Abstract:
From 1974 to 1980, 57 consecutive cases of children with tracheobronchial foreign bodies were treated by a new protocol in which peripherally located foreign bodies were treated nonoperatively and centrally located foreign bodies were removed bronchoscopically. Bronchoscopic removal was ultimately successful in all of the 29 children in whom the foreign body was located in the trachea or mainstem bronchus. There were eight minor complications, and in three instances it was necessary to repeat the bronchoscopy for retained fragments. In the other 28 children the foreign body was located in the segmental or lobar bronchi, and initial treatment consisted of a program employing inhalation bronchodilators, pulmonary drainage, and thoracic percussion. Treatment was successful (foreign body coughed out) in 18 patients (64%). Of the other 10 children subsequent bronchoscopy was successful in eight and failed in two patients. Of the latter patients, one required bronchotomy, and the other coughed out the foreign body. There were no deaths, major complications, or permanent pulmonary damage in either treatment series.
